'''Duties'''

  • Provide support and assistance to individuals in their daily activities
  • Assist with personal care tasks such as bathing, dressing, and grooming
  • Help with meal preparation and feeding
  • Administer medications as directed by healthcare professionals
  • Assist with mobility and transfers, including heavy lifting if necessary
  • Provide companionship and emotional support to individuals
  • Monitor and report any changes in the individual's condition to the appropriate healthcare professionals
  • Maintain a clean and safe environment for individuals
'''Qualifications'''

  • Previous experience in a similar role, preferably in senior care or nursing home settings
  • Knowledge of dementia care techniques and strategies
  • Ability to perform heavy lifting and physical tasks as required
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ills
  • Compassionate and patient demeanor
  • Ability to follow instructions and work effectively as part of a team
  • Flexibility to work various shifts, including weekends and holidays
